Is watermelon OK for dogs?

Yes, watermelon can be a healthy and safe snack for dogs, in small quantities. Make sure to remove the rind, seeds, and any additional sweeteners before giving any to your pup. Watermelon is low in calories and a good source of vitamins A, B6, and C, as well as potassium and magnesium.

However, it is also high in natural sugars and should be limited to a few small slices per day. Additionally, some dogs may be sensitive to certain fruits and watermelon is no exception. Monitor your pup closely after feeding to ensure no adverse reactions.

Can dogs eat bananas?

Yes, it is perfectly safe for dogs to eat bananas in moderation. Bananas are a good source of several important vitamins and minerals like Vitamin B6, Vitamin C, fiber, manganese and potassium. They can be a great snack for dogs and provide them with some energy.

While a few bites of banana should not cause dogs any harm, it is important to bear in mind that bananas should not make up a large part of a dog’s diet and should not replace food that is nutritionally balanced.

Too much banana can cause upset stomach and other digestive issues, so it is best to give it in moderation. Before serving any type of human food to your dog, it is also important to talk to your veterinarian for expert advice.
